    the fun part.

    Well, my advice, take your sweet time. Don't cheap out the first go around. And don't be afraid to use it as it is right now. The more you use it, the more you'll figure out what it is you want to do. Can take these trucks a lot of places with just some nice tires. The build can go a lot of directions.

    my god yes, take your time and do it right the first go around. Only problem you can only do it right if you know what you want to do. So go out with some people if possible and do a bit of rock crawling, desert go fasting, overlanding...something in between, and build from there. It’s a long process lol
